U.S. soccer star has everything going for her after gold-medal effort, from
TV appearances to a series of books she will write.
Everybody, it seems, wants
something from Alex Morgan. Or
perhaps that should say everything, because Morgan's popularity hasn't
been limited to one species since she won an Olympic gold medal in soccer last
month.
Thursday night a family of persistent raccoons came scratching at the door of her Manhattan Beach apartment. And that comes on the stilettoed heels of her first walk down the runway in a New York fashion show, ringing the opening bell at the New York Stock Exchange — on 9/11, no less — a photo shoot with Nike and TV appearances on the "Today" show and "Live!" with Kelly Ripa.
